In Slothee Wants Coffee, Slothee travels from Costa Rica to Brazil, Colombia, Indonesia, Ethiopia, and Hawaii in search of the perfect cup of coffee. On the way, he meets new friends and learns about coffee and culture. Will Slothee find the best cup of coffee? Read this book to join him on an educational, yet fun adventure!

THE INSPIRATION 

After traveling domestically and internationally, the inspiration behind ‘Slothee Wants Coffee’ comes from the love of exploration (and coffee)! As a single mom, my goal is to set my son up for success and allow him to experience new surroundings. Slothee and Slothee’s mom represent that relationship and desire to encourage learning through discovery.

On a trip to Costa Rica, we fell in love with sloths, seeing them in the rainforests and watching their slow, yet smooth movements. It is our spirit-animal! After taking a coffee (and chocolate) tour, we learned that there is much more than just brewing a cup of coffee. From bean to your cup, it is a process. We wanted to bring that process to life and add fun facts in the book that kids can understand and relate to.

Throughout this book, we hope to excite children and parents to explore cultures outside of the norm. Not only will you meet Slothee’s friends, but you will learn about coffee and traditions. Travel virtually to different countries with Slothee!

THE AUTHORS

Nikki Pezzopane

Nikki is originally from Metro Detroit but moved to Arizona in high school. She attended Northern Arizona University in Flagstaff, receiving a Bachelor’s in Criminal Justice and Criminology. Nikki also earned a Master’s in Forensic Psychology from Argosy University. However, she realized her heart wasn’t with her degree path and took a different route in life by starting a Digital Marketing/Social Media Management company in 2014. Nikki always had a love for writing, even at a young age, so she was inspired by Cameron’s idea, and together they wrote Slothee Wants Coffee. She also has a passion for travel, having traveled to 38 states and 16 countries. 

Cameron Fica

Cameron has a passion for traveling and went on an airplane for the first time at 3-months old. He is 8-years old, has lived in 3 states, and traveled to 14 countries and 22 states. Cameron loves sloths and came up with the idea of Slothee Wants Coffee during a trip to Costa Rica. He also loves playing on the beach, science experiments, and playing Roblox.
